  1. I recall seeing a large black cat (3ft tall, about 5 or 6 ft long with tail) while squirel hunting in the late 70's along the Trinity river near Rye, TX. It was running across an open pasture, away from me. I was too young to be scared, but should have been. I also saw a very unusual cat while a work in the early 90's east of Baytown. This cat was about the same size as the other but smaller in frame, skinnier with long legs and a long curled tail. This cat was brown with what looked like tiger type stripes, not as distinct as a real tiger but more mottled. I was in a remote building with a large window and watched this cat for 2-3 minutes just walking around. It was only 30 or 40 foot from where is was, I had a very good view. Someone told me that it was a mexican mountain lion but I never found anything like it in any book or online. Anyone seen anything like this?
